How are bacterial cells typically made competent to facilitate the uptake of recombinant DNA during transformation?

विकल्प

  • By treatment with calcium ions followed by heat shock

  • By washing with heavy metals at sub-zero temperatures

  • By exposure to boiling water and continuous agitation

  • By incubating with cellulase and chitinase enzymes

MCQ
Advertisements

उत्तर

To enable bacterial cells to take up foreign recombinant DNA, they are treated with divalent cations like calcium ions, followed by a brief heat shock to increase membrane permeability.
